How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 90036?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
90036 Studio Apartments | $2,314 | $1,400 | $4,130 |
90036 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,981 | $1,230 | $5,840 |
90036 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,965 | $1,650 | $8,220 |
90036 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,641 | $3,595 | $9,500 |
90036 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,101 | $4,901 | $5,301 |
